Frail patients face higher kidney risk during surgery

NCT ID NCT07030179

First seen Nov 01, 2025 · Last updated May 16, 2026 · Updated 22 times

Summary

This study looks at whether being frail before surgery raises the chance of kidney injury afterward. Researchers will track 1000 adults having non-cardiac surgery and measure blood pressure changes during the operation. The goal is to understand how frailty and blood pressure together affect kidney health, which could help doctors better protect at-risk patients.
